如何将进销存系统与POS机进行有效连接?

2024-10-05 发布
如何将进销存系统与POS机进行有效连接?

现代商业环境中,进销存管理系统与POS(Point of Sale,销售点)系统的集成已成为企业提高运营效率和管理能力的关键手段。正确配置并连接这两个系统,不仅能够实现库存与销售数据的实时同步,还能为企业提供准确的销售分析和预测,从而支持更明智的商业决策。

进销存与POS机连接的重要性

对于任何一家零售商或批发商来说,进销存系统(Inventory Management System,简称IMS)和POS系统都是非常重要的业务工具。前者用于管理商品入库、出库、库存查询等,而后者则主要用于销售交易的记录、结算及打印发票等。两者独立运作时,虽然也能完成基本任务,但信息孤岛现象会严重影响企业的运营效率。比如,当某个产品在POS系统中被售出后,若未及时更新到进销存系统,则可能导致库存数量不准,进而影响后续的采购计划和销售策略。反之亦然,如果库存信息无法及时反映在POS系统上,销售人员可能因为不了解库存情况而错失销售机会。因此,将进销存系统与POS机进行有效连接显得尤为重要。

连接前的准备工作

在正式实施进销存与POS机的连接之前,我们需要做一系列准备工作。首先,明确双方系统的具体需求。这包括确认POS系统是否支持与特定进销存软件进行对接,以及该进销存软件能否提供所需的接口或API(应用程序编程接口)。此外,还需考虑硬件设备的兼容性问题,确保POS机具备足够的处理能力和存储空间来运行相关软件。其次,评估现有业务流程。这一步骤旨在识别哪些环节需要改进以适应新的集成方案,并制定相应的培训计划,使员工尽快熟悉新系统。最后,制定详细的项目计划,设定明确的时间表和里程碑,以便跟踪进度和控制成本。

连接步骤详解

第一步:选择合适的接口方式。常见的接口类型包括但不限于数据库直连、Web Service、SDK(Software Development Kit)、API等方式。其中,数据库直连最为直接简单,只需将两个系统的数据库进行链接即可,适用于同品牌或高度兼容的系统;而Web Service和API接口则更加灵活,可以跨越不同的操作系统和编程语言环境,实现跨平台通信。具体选用哪种方式取决于双方系统的技术架构及企业自身的技术实力。

第二步:安装必要的中间件或驱动程序。某些情况下,为了保障数据传输的安全性和稳定性,可能需要额外安装一些中间件或驱动程序。例如,使用Web Service接口时,往往还需要安装SOAP(Simple Object Access Protocol)协议相关的组件;而在使用API接口时,则可能需要用到专门的数据加密工具来保护敏感信息不被泄露。

第三步:配置参数设置。这一步涉及到对双方系统参数进行合理配置,以保证数据交换过程中的准确性。具体操作步骤如下:

  1. 确定数据字段映射关系:将进销存系统中的每个字段与POS系统中对应的字段建立一一对应的关系,确保信息能够正确传输。例如,在进销存系统中,商品编号通常被称为“Item Code”,而在POS系统中可能表示为“Product ID”。通过仔细检查和校验这些字段映射,可以避免因命名差异导致的数据丢失问题。
  2. 调整时间戳规则:考虑到不同系统间可能存在时间差,需要对时间戳规则进行适当调整,确保所有交易记录均按照统一标准保存。例如,可以在进销存系统中添加一个“交易日期”字段,并将其值设置为POS系统记录交易时的实际时间。
  3. 启用数据同步机制:设置自动或手动触发的数据同步规则,确保每次交易完成后,POS系统中的数据能立即更新到进销存系统中。同时,也要定期执行全量同步,以保持长期的数据一致性。

第四步:测试与调试。完成上述配置后,接下来就是进行严格的测试工作,以验证整个连接过程是否正常运行。测试内容主要包括以下几点:

  1. 模拟交易场景:通过人工操作或自动化脚本模拟实际交易流程,观察交易完成后,进销存系统中的库存变化情况。注意检查是否有数据丢失或错误现象发生。
  2. 压力测试:对连接后的系统施加大量并发请求,检验其在高负载条件下的稳定性和响应速度。这对于保证业务高峰期的流畅体验至关重要。
  3. 故障恢复测试:人为制造网络中断、数据库故障等情况,考察系统能否快速恢复正常运行,并且数据完整性不受损害。
  4. 安全性测试:利用各种渗透测试工具,检查整个数据传输链路是否存在安全漏洞,特别是涉及财务敏感信息的部分。确保所有数据都经过了加密处理,防止被非法窃取。

常见问题及解决方案

尽管大多数情况下,进销存系统与POS机的连接过程相对顺利,但仍有可能遇到一些棘手的问题。下面我们将列举几个典型的挑战,并给出相应的解决策略:

  1. 接口不兼容:不同供应商提供的进销存系统和POS机可能采用不同的通信协议或接口标准,导致直接对接困难。此时,应优先考虑寻找具有跨平台支持能力的第三方适配器或转换工具;如果实在无法找到现成的解决方案,则可能需要定制开发一套专门的中间件来完成数据转换工作。
  2. 数据同步延迟:即便实现了初步的数据同步,也可能出现部分交易记录未能及时更新到另一端的情况。为解决此问题,一方面可以通过优化网络带宽分配、增加缓存机制等方式减少传输时延;另一方面,还可以引入分布式事务处理框架,确保每一次交易都能以原子性方式完整记录于两个系统之中。
  3. 数据一致性:由于种种原因,如网络波动、硬件故障等,可能会造成两个系统间的数据不一致。对此,建议采取版本控制策略,为每次成功交易赋予唯一的版本号,并通过定期执行全量比较操作来发现并修正差异项。另外,也可以引入基于区块链技术的数据溯源系统,增强数据变更历史的可追溯性。
  4. 性能瓶颈:随着业务规模不断扩大,原有的硬件设施或软件架构可能无法承载日益增长的数据处理需求,导致系统响应变慢甚至崩溃。这时,可以考虑升级服务器硬件资源,或者对现有架构进行重构,比如采用微服务模式来分散计算压力。
  5. 安全性风险:开放式的数据接口容易成为黑客攻击的目标,一旦遭到入侵,将对企业的财产安全构成严重威胁。除了加强边界防护措施外,还应加强对传输过程中的数据加密力度,并定期开展内部安全审计工作,杜绝潜在隐患。

未来发展趋势

随着云计算、大数据等新兴技术的发展,未来的进销存系统与POS机的集成将呈现以下几个显著趋势:

  1. 云端部署:越来越多的企业倾向于将业务系统迁移到云端,借助云服务商的强大算力和弹性扩展能力,轻松应对业务高峰。这样一来,进销存系统与POS机也可以通过云平台实现无缝对接,大大简化了部署流程。
  2. 智能化分析:通过对海量销售数据进行深度挖掘和分析,不仅可以帮助商家更好地理解客户需求,还能根据历史销售记录预测未来趋势。因此,未来的集成方案中很可能包含更多的智能分析模块,用以辅助决策制定。
  3. 移动端支持:手机和平板电脑已经成为日常生活中不可或缺的一部分,因此,移动版的进销存系统和POS应用也应运而生。通过智能手机,工作人员可以随时随地查看库存状态、处理订单或完成收款操作,极大地提高了工作效率。
  4. 物联网技术融合:随着物联网技术的进步,越来越多的商品开始具备RFID标签或传感器等标识装置,可以实时监测其位置和状态。利用这些设备收集的信息,不仅可以精确掌握货物动向,还能为仓库管理提供有力支持。预计未来集成方案中,将会更多地引入物联网元素,实现线上线下全渠道的联动。

结论

综上所述,将进销存系统与POS机进行有效连接,不仅可以提升企业的运营效率和服务水平,还能为其带来显著的竞争优势。尽管这一过程中可能会遇到各种技术难题,但只要做好充分准备,选对合适的方法,并持续关注行业动态,相信任何企业都能够克服这些障碍,迈向成功。